Residential window repl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ged windows and installing new, energy-efficient units. This process typically includes selecting the appropriate window styles, measuring openings accurately, and ensuring proper installation to enhance the property's overall appearance and functionality. Professional service providers focus on minimizing disruption during the replacement process and ensuring that the new windows are properly sealed to prevent drafts and water infiltration.
These services address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Old or damaged windows can compromise a home's comfort by allowing heat to escape during colder months and letting in unwanted heat during warmer periods. Replacing windows can also improve security and reduce exterior noise, creating a more comfortable living environment.

Average Cost Range - Residential window replacement costs typically range from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, standard double-pane windows in Mansfield, TX, may fall within this range. Costs can vary based on specific project requirements and local market conditions.
Material Impact on Costs - The choice of window material influences the overall expense. Vinyl windows often cost between $300 and $700 each, while wood or fiberglass options may range from $500 to over $1,000 per window. Local pros can help determine the best material for budget and performance needs.
Installation Expenses - Installation fees for residential window replacement generally add $150 to $300 per window. These costs depend on the complexity of the job, existing window condition, and accessibility in Mansfield, TX. Professional service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ific projects.
Additional Costs to Consider - Factors such as removing old windows, upgrading to energy-efficient models, or custom sizes can increase the total cost. Extra charges may range from $50 to $200 per window for these services. Local pros can clarify what is included in their pricing and any potential additional exp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
